Abstract

Twenty-two compounds belonging to halogenated 4-alkyl-4′′-cyano-p-terphenyls have been synthesized and mesomorphic properties using polarizing optical microscope and differential scanning calorimetry have been determined. The birefringence of the compounds using prism coupling technique was determinated. The multicomponent eutectic mixture consisted of synthesised compounds was prepared and investigated. The prepared mixture exhibits very broad nematic phase range, over 140 °C, with the melting point below 0 °C. Dielectric studies revealed that prepared mixture is very useful for dual frequency adressing system, because it posses large positive dielectric anisotropy (above 22) and becomes negative above the relatively low cross-over frequency (14 kHz). The total response time of the prepared mixture measured at room temperature at low operating voltage (24 V) is short (6.5 ms) which is suitable for fast switching optical applications.
